Status Bar

You can display or not display the status bar on the bottom of the Main Console
screen. The status bar shows the purpose of the selected menu item or tool bar button,
and the status of the selected directory entry. Error messages may also appear on the
status bar.
To display the Status Bar:
— Select Status Bar from the Toolbars menu in the View drop-down menu. The
status bar, as shown below, appears.
On the right-hand side of the status bar, there are six boxes. These boxes display short
messages indicating when the listed features are enabled or a message is waiting. The
features are, in order:

When not in DND, the DND area is grayed put. When in DND, the sta-
tus area turns red (red is used in the directory to signify DND). If you
right click on the status area, a menu appears that allows you to turn
DND on or off for your station.
When not forwarded, the FWD area is grayed put. When forwarded,
the status area turns blue (blue is used in the directory to signify for-
ward). If you right click on the status area, a menu appears that allows
you to turn forwarding on or off for your station, as shown below.
Message Received. When there are messages, the status area turns
green. You can either double click the MSG area to display the Mes-
sages dialog, or you can right click to display a menu that will bring up
the message dialog
When not connected to a call, the mute area is grayed put. When con-
nected to a call and not muted, the MUTE area is visible. When con-
nected to a call and muted, the status area turns red. You can double-
click the mute area to toggle the mute status, or right click to display a
menu that will toggle mute.
When all OAI connections are up, the LINK button is grayed put. This
status indicates that the Console is connected to an OAI Server. If one
or more connections are down, the status area turns yellow. You can
double-click the link status area to display the connection status (see
page
26), or right click to display a menu that will bring up the connec-
tion status.
